Position Title:
Sterile Processing Tech - Student Only - Adult SPD - PRNDepartment:
Adult Sterile ProcessingJob Description:
While enrolled in school, the Sterile Processing Student PRN works under supervision to clean, decontaminate, assemble, package, and sterilize surgical instruments and reusable supply items.
Essential Responsibilities:
Responsibilities listed in this section are core to the position. Inability to perform these responsibilities with or without accommodation may result in disqualification from the position.
- Assembles and wraps instrument sets.
- Ensures proper use of sterilized sonic cleaners and other related equipment.
- Delivers surgical instruments on a timely basis.
- Thoroughly inspects instruments to ensure all instruments are clean and in good repair/working order prior to sterilization process.
- Decontaminates instruments using proper chemical mixtures and procedures.
- Tests, operates, and loads autoclaves.
- Participates in the routine cleaning and decontamination of all department work surfaces.
- Completes sterilization log sheets.
- Periodically checks sterile inventory in order to remove those items in which sterilization has expired or packaging has been compromised.
- Re-sterilizes compromised instrument sets.
- Identifies and notifies appropriate personnel of inventory or supply shortages.
- Follows Universal Precautions by wearing the appropriate protective attire while working in the Decontamination area.
- Decontaminates surgical instruments and other medical equipment as needed by keeping a continuous flow of instrumentation moving through the process.
- Utilizes appropriate cleaning detergents and agents by reading directions and MSDS sheets.

Minimum Qualifications:
Education: High School Diploma or GED required. Must be enrolled in a Certified Sterile Processing and Distribution Technician (CSPDT) or Certified Registered Central Service Technician (CRCST) program
Experience: No experience required.
Licensure/Certifications/Registrations Required:Certified Sterile Processing and Distribution Technician (CSPDT) issued by the Certification Board for Sterile Processing and Distribution (CBSPD) or Certified Registered Central Service Technician (CRCST) issued by the Healthcare Sterile Processing Association (HSPA) required within 18 months of hire.
